What’s the Brian Head ski resort?

What began as a one-chairlift operation in 1965, identified initially as Monument Peak because of its excessive elevation, has grown. Not solely that, however with the very best base elevation in all of Utah at 9,600 toes, Brian Head Ski Resort has some legit snow and runs.

Brian Head’s snowfall averages are available in at 360 inches throughout its 650 acres and two related mountains, every with its personal base space.

The resort boasts 71 ski runs and eight chair lifts. To present some context, Breckenridge Resort in Colorado averages an identical quantity of snow at 355 inches yearly and has 35 chair lifts. In different phrases, Brian Head has strong snowfall and is smaller than some ski resorts, but it surely additionally is not so small that you simply’re relegated to only a daytrip.

Brian Head sometimes opens for the season in mid-to-late November and closes in mid-April, circumstances allowing, with lifts open from 10 a.m. to 4 p.m. on weekdays and 9:30 a.m. to 4:30 p.m. on weekends and holidays. As well as, it is likely one of the resorts that gives night time snowboarding on Fridays and Saturdays by way of the Blackfoot Carry till 9 p.m., with costs beginning at $25.

The place is Brian Head ski resort?

Like many ski resorts, Brian Head is somewhat off the overwhelmed path, in that it is a few hours from any main metropolis.

Nevertheless, it is only a snowball’s throw from Interstate Freeway 15 in Parowan, Utah, which makes it comparatively straightforward to get to, even when it takes a few hours to take action from both Las Vegas (2.5 hours) or Salt Lake Metropolis (3.5 hours). It is also one hour from Zion National Park and 35 minutes from Cedar Metropolis, which is the place you may discover quite a lot of (often) inexpensive finances and midrange resorts, similar to a Courtyard by Marriott, Vacation Inn Categorical, Hampton Inn and Finest Western.

There is a free shuttle that can take you the 14 miles up the mountain to Brian Head, which will be further helpful in winter driving circumstances. However for those who do make the drive up the mountain your self, parking is free at Large Steps Lodge and Navajo Lodge (house allowing), with learners and people with classes probably desirous to park at Navajo Lodge.

Brian Head raise tickets

Here is the place we get to the actually good elements about Brian Head; the low price of raise tickets.

First, know that youngsters 12 and underneath ski without cost with no restrictions or necessities, apart from you want to signal them up for the free Energy Children Go, which you are able to do on-line in only a minute or two. That is unusually easy on the planet of kids-ski-free choices. On high of that, these ages 75 and up may ski without cost with out restrictions, which can be fairly uncommon lately. That is what gave beginning to our three-generation ski journey concept because the youngest and oldest within the group would ski free.

SUMMER HULL/THE POINTS GUY

For everybody else, raise ticket costs begin at $29 per day, with a standard supply being $10 in included “Corduroy Money” with every ticket to spend on issues like mountain eating, classes, purchasing and tools leases.

Costs aren’t all the time fairly that low, however $45-$60 per day is frequent a lot of the season, with advance buy costs topping out round $99 on probably the most peak days, like President’s Day weekend, so long as you e book no less than 5 days out. Examine that to raise ticket costs of $200-$300-plus per day at many main ski resorts for those who do not plan months upfront to buy one thing like Epic or Ikon Passes, and it is an enormous distinction, particularly since children ski free.

Professional tip: Brian Head generally has a 20% off sale on reward playing cards throughout Black Friday that you would use to decrease your efficient price much more.

How a lot does it price to ski at Brian Head?

Along with the affordable raise ticket costs that we simply mentioned, you may have another prices to ski. On-site gear leases at Brian Head begin at $25 per day throughout March and April in 2024 however can price $35-$40 per day for a primary grownup ski rental bundle for the remainder of the season.

SUMMER HULL/THE POINTS GUY

Group ski college for teenagers 7-12 years previous begins at $145 for a half-day and $310 for a full day with lunch, so whereas that’s lower than at another mountains, it is nonetheless a hefty sum you may wish to finances for. Snowboarding throughout weekends and holidays will drive these costs upward some, in addition to not reserving no less than 5 days out.

If you’d like a personal lesson, these are less expensive at Brian Head than many different mountains, as half-day non-public classes will be had beginning round $250, when that quantity can simply method $1,000 elsewhere.

Suggestions for snowboarding at Brian Head

  • Parking is free at Brian Head, however the tons can replenish on busy days within the late morning, so I like to recommend arriving about half-hour earlier than lifts open to have a straightforward decide of spots to park.
  • Lifts opened at 9:30 a.m. whereas we had been there, and the primary half-hour or so had been devoid of any noticeable raise strains, which made for a good way to get in a couple of fast runs earlier than the strains did develop on the busy lengthy weekend.
  • Like at most ski resorts, you’re finest served to keep away from the bottom raise strains throughout peak hours for those who can.
  • Try to eat early — particularly if it’s a busy weekend — as meals strains can get very lengthy, particularly on the Navajo facet of the resort, as there aren’t a ton of retailers to select from. I like to recommend checking lunch off the record by 11:30 a.m. if potential, and definitely earlier than half-day ski college will get out at 12:30 p.m. That is whenever you’ll wish to head again up the mountain whereas the raise strains are barely shorter.
  • Talking of the Navajo facet, that mountain has extra beginner-friendly terrain. However, as quickly as your group can graduate to straightforward blues, we discovered the Large Steps facet to be a bit much less crowded. You possibly can nonetheless do a couple of inexperienced runs there off the Blackfoot raise that had considerably shorter strains than the first specific lifts.
  • Do not skip snow tubing, as it is also a great worth at $25 for limitless runs for 90 minutes.
  • When you need not make your Brian Head purchases months upfront simply to make them inexpensive, you’ll want to do it no less than every week or so upfront of your journey, as costs soar 15% inside 5 days and 30% inside 24 hours.
